Digital Hardware - Electrical Engineer

Hidden Level is transforming airspace safety with innovative, scalable drone detection and airspace technology. We provide real-time, actionable data to enhance security across various environments. As we expand, we're looking for an Electrical Engineer who will apply their skills and experience to lead the design of custom hardware and firmware for cutting-edge sensor and communication systems.

 

This position is located in the Syracuse, NY office

 

Responsibilities:

  • Perform part selection, schematic design, and aid in layout activities
  • Maintain component libraries and create new parts for schematic capture
  • Perform functional test and verification activities for new hardware and aid in production transition and support
  • Design HDL solutions for the latest Xilinx FPGAs and SoC devices
  • Perform timing closure and create well constrained, maintainable solutions that are easily extensible and employ an efficient use of resources
  • Use scripting languages such as Python and Bash to automate and improve workflows

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related field
  • 0-5 years related professional experience
  • Understanding of digital and analog circuits
  • Experience with VHDL and/or Verilog to configure FPGAs and other embedded systems

 

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ience testing and validating analog and digital hardware using oscilloscopes, network analyzers, logic analyzers, spectrum analyzers, etc.
  • Experience with modern Xilinx FPGAs and the Vivado design environment
  • Experience with Communication and Sensor systems, Digital Signal Processing, Software Defined Radios, and RF System Design
  • Experience with Matlab, Python, Linux
